Colonial Town Guerrero is an agricultural state whose leading crops are maize, sesame, and coconuts. Tourism is an important element in the economy, and mining, manufacturing, forestry, and fishing also provide income. Acapulco, a major port during the colonial period, is Mexico's most famous ocean resort, and Taxco de Alarcon is a beautifully preserved colonial town. The Grutas de Caca-huamilpa, protected as a national park, includes some of the largest caves in Mexico.

QUANTICO, kwon'ti-ko, town, Virginia, on the Potomac River in Prince William County, 29 miles southwest of Washington, D.C. During the American Revolution colonial vessels were serviced here and in 1917 a training base for the Marine Corps was added. Today second lieutenants in the Marine Corps receive their basic training at this base. Prince William Forest Park, for recreation, is nearby. The town serves an area of diversified farms. Pop., not including marines, 1,015.
